Xinjiang International Grand Bazaar
Kickstart your second day in Urumqi with a vibrant plunge into local culture at the Xinjiang International Grand Bazaar. As the largest bazaar in the world with an Islamic flair, it's a bustling hub where you can spend a couple of hours exploring an array of exotic goods. From intricate handmade carpets and colorful Uygur costumes to a variety of spices and dried fruits, the bazaar offers an authentic taste of Xinjiang's rich heritage. The lively atmosphere, coupled with the architectural marvel of the bazaar, makes for an unforgettable shopping and cultural experience.
Attraction Info
- No. 8, Jiefang South Road, Tianshan District, Urumqi
- Suggested tour duration: 2-3 hour
- Open 24 hours

Hongshan Park
After immersing yourself in the bustling market life, find a peaceful retreat at Hongshan Park, a serene city park nestled in the heart of Urumqi. Allowing for a three-hour escape, this green oasis is the perfect spot to unwind and enjoy nature's beauty. The park's name, meaning 'Red Mountain,' comes from the reddish sandstone hills that provide a stunning backdrop to the lush landscapes. Stroll along the winding paths, admire the traditional Chinese pavilions, and if you're up for it, climb to the top of Hongshan for a panoramic view of Urumqi.
Attraction Info
- No. 40, North 1st Lane, Hongshan Road, Shuimogou District, Urumqi City
- Suggested tour duration: 3 hour
- Open from 7:30am-11:00pm

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region Museum
Conclude your Urumqi exploration with a visit to the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region Museum. Spend about two hours delving into the region's history and culture through its extensive collection of artifacts. The museum is a treasure trove of Silk Road relics, ethnic handicrafts, and even well-preserved mummies that offer a glimpse into ancient civilizations. The exhibits not only highlight the diversity of the local ethnic groups but also tell the story of how this area has been a cultural and commercial crossroads for centuries.
Attraction Info
- No. 581, Northwest Road, Shayibake District, Urumqi
- Suggested tour duration: 2-3 hour
- Open on Tue-Sun,10:30am-6:00pm;Closed on Mon;Open from 10:30am-6:00pm during Chinese public holidays
